Mercedes-Benz EQS 450+ vs Renault 5 E-Tech 150: London to Sofia

Which EV is faster on the 2439km route? <strong>Mercedes-Benz EQS 450+</strong> wins by 121 minutes with 7 charging stops.

In our London to Sofia EV duel, the Mercedes-Benz EQS 450+ beats the Renault 5 E-Tech 150 by 121 minutes, completing the 2439km route in 25h 40min. The key advantage? 8 fewer charging stops. Route calculated on September 4, 2026 using real-time charging station data.

The Mercedes-Benz EQS 450+ needs only 7 charging stops compared to 15 for the slowest vehicle, saving valuable time.

Quick Comparison

Metric Mercedes-Benz EQS 450+ Renault 5 E-Tech 150
Travel time 25h 40min 27h 41min
Charging time: 2h 19min 3h 35min
Charging stops: 7 15
Energy used ~439 kWh ~440 kWh

Frequently Asked Questions

How accurate is the EV range calculation?

Our calculations use real-world consumption data and actual charging curves from GoingElectric database. Results account for highway speeds, temperature assumptions, and real charger locations along your route.

Can I compare more than 2 EVs at once?

Yes! EV Duel lets you race up to 4 electric vehicles simultaneously on any route. Watch them compete in real-time and see which one arrives first with the fewest charging stops.

What charging networks are supported?

We support major charging networks including Tesla Supercharger, Ionity, Fastned, and all CCS-compatible chargers across Europe. You can also compare different networks to see which gets you there fastest.
